This is a carpenter's "sumi-tsubo ( ink liner )" made of wood and has an ink pot and a wheel. It has ink soaked floss silk in the pot. It is used by a carpenter when he draws a line on a lumber. One of the end of the string is pinned, stretched and snapped so that the line is drawn. It has been commonly used till mid 20th century. This one has a carved turtle. In good condition. 20th century. L:24cm W:9.5cm H:8.3cm

This is a small zanshi-ori rug. Zanshi-ori is a cloth handwoven of leftover threads. It has a few layers of cloth and has beautiful gradation of natural indigo color. In good condition but has some wear and mending patches. The former half of the 20th century. 120cm x 120cm

This is a set of suō and hakama which are worn on a stage or at a ceremony. Suō (top) is a wide-sleeved overgarment worn by samurai. They are made of hemp. The suō has laces in front and ornaments in the crests made of deerskin. Generally in good condition but has some stains. 19th century. Suō:184cm x 84cm Hakama:L 83cm

This is a cotton Kurume kasuri futonji. It is said that Kurume kasuri was first woven ca.1800 in Kurume in Fukuoka Pref. in Kyushu. Its features are geometric and wood block like patterns and some have light blue indigo color. It was designated as important intangible cultural heritage in 1957, however only a few families are practicing traditional way of produce such as hand-binding, natural indigo-dyeing and hand-weaving these days.
